博客 知识库构建技术:语义分析与向量检索的实现

知识库构建技术:语义分析与向量检索的实现

   数栈君   发表于 2026-02-20 14:57  34  0

在当今数据驱动的时代,知识库构建技术已成为企业数字化转型的核心驱动力之一。通过语义分析与向量检索的结合,企业能够更高效地管理和利用海量数据,从而提升决策能力和竞争力。本文将深入探讨知识库构建技术的实现细节,包括语义分析与向量检索的关键步骤、应用场景以及对企业业务的深远影响。


什么是知识库构建?

知识库构建是指通过技术手段将分散的、非结构化的数据转化为结构化的知识库,使其能够被计算机理解和应用。知识库通常以图结构或向量形式存储,包含实体、关系和属性等信息,能够支持智能问答、推荐系统、数据分析等多种应用场景。

知识库构建的核心目标是将数据转化为可计算的、可理解的形式,从而为企业提供更高效的决策支持。申请试用相关工具可以帮助企业快速搭建和管理知识库。


语义分析:从数据到知识的桥梁

语义分析是知识库构建的关键技术之一,其目的是理解文本中的语义信息,提取有用的知识。语义分析主要包括以下步骤:

1. 自然语言处理(NLP)

自然语言处理是语义分析的基础,主要包括分词、词性标注、实体识别、句法分析和语义角色标注等步骤。通过这些技术,可以将文本分解为有意义的片段,并提取其中的实体、关系和属性。

  • 分词:将文本分割成词语或短语,例如将“北京是中国的首都”分割为“北京”、“是”、“中国”、“首都”。
  • 词性标注:为每个词语标注词性,例如“北京”是名词,“是”是动词。
  • 实体识别:识别文本中的实体,例如“北京”是地名,“中国”是国家。
  • 句法分析:分析句子的语法结构,例如“北京是首都”可以被解析为“主语-谓语-宾语”结构。
  • 语义角色标注:分析词语在句子中的语义角色,例如“北京”是“主语”,“首都”是“宾语”。

2. 知识抽取

在语义分析的基础上,可以通过知识抽取技术从文本中提取实体、关系和属性。例如,从“李明是北京大学的教授”中可以提取以下信息:

  • 实体:李明、北京大学
  • 关系:李明是北京大学的教授
  • 属性:李明的职位是教授

3. 知识融合

知识融合是将从不同来源提取的知识进行整合,消除冗余和冲突。例如,从多个来源提取的“李明是北京大学的教授”信息需要进行去重和统一。

4. 知识存储

提取和融合后的知识需要存储在知识库中,通常以图结构或向量形式存储。图结构适合表示实体之间的关系,而向量形式适合表示文本的语义信息。


向量检索:基于语义的高效查询

向量检索是知识库构建的另一项核心技术,其目的是通过向量表示实现高效的语义检索。向量检索的核心思想是将文本或知识表示为向量,然后通过向量相似度计算来匹配相关结果。

1. 向量空间模型

向量空间模型是向量检索的基础,其核心思想是将文本映射到高维向量空间中。每个文本可以表示为一个向量,向量的维度通常与词表大小或嵌入维度相关。例如,对于文本“李明是北京大学的教授”,可以将其映射为一个高维向量。

2. 向量表示

向量表示是将文本或知识转换为向量的过程,通常使用词嵌入技术(如Word2Vec、GloVe)或句子嵌入技术(如BERT、Sentence-BERT)。词嵌入技术将词语映射为向量,而句子嵌入技术将整个句子映射为向量。

3. 相似度计算

在向量空间模型中,可以通过相似度计算来衡量两个向量的语义相似性。常用的相似度计算方法包括:

  • 余弦相似度:计算两个向量的夹角余弦值,范围在[-1, 1]之间。
  • 欧氏距离:计算两个向量在空间中的距离,范围在[0, ∞)之间。

4. 向量索引

为了提高检索效率,通常需要对向量进行索引。常用的向量索引技术包括:

  • 倒排索引:将向量按维度进行索引,适用于高维向量。
  • ANN索引:使用近似最近邻算法(ANN)进行快速检索,适用于大规模数据。

知识库构建在数据中台中的应用

数据中台是企业数字化转型的重要基础设施,其核心目标是整合多源数据,提供统一的数据视图。知识库构建技术在数据中台中的应用主要体现在以下几个方面:

1. 数据整合

通过知识库构建技术,可以将来自不同系统和格式的数据整合到一个统一的知识库中,例如将结构化数据(如数据库表)和非结构化数据(如文本、图像)进行统一存储和管理。

2. 数据关联

知识库构建技术可以通过语义分析和向量检索,实现数据之间的关联。例如,可以通过知识库将“李明”与“北京大学”、“教授”等实体进行关联,从而形成完整的知识图谱。

3. 数据洞见

通过知识库构建技术,可以提取数据中的隐含关系和模式,从而为企业提供更深入的数据洞见。例如,可以通过知识库分析“李明”与“北京大学”的关系,进而推断出“李明”可能的研究领域或学术成就。


知识库构建在数字孪生中的应用

数字孪生是近年来备受关注的新兴技术,其核心目标是通过数字模型实现物理世界的实时映射。知识库构建技术在数字孪生中的应用主要体现在以下几个方面:

1. 实时数据整合

数字孪生需要实时整合来自传感器、数据库和外部系统的数据,知识库构建技术可以通过语义分析和向量检索,实现实时数据的快速整合和关联。

2. 动态更新

数字孪生需要支持动态更新,知识库构建技术可以通过持续学习和更新,实现知识库的动态更新。例如,当传感器数据发生变化时,知识库可以实时更新相关实体和关系。

3. 智能决策

数字孪生需要支持智能决策,知识库构建技术可以通过语义分析和向量检索,实现基于知识的智能决策。例如,可以通过知识库分析设备的运行状态,进而推断出设备的维护需求。


知识库构建在数字可视化中的应用

数字可视化是将数据转化为可视化形式的重要技术,其核心目标是通过直观的展示方式帮助用户理解和分析数据。知识库构建技术在数字可视化中的应用主要体现在以下几个方面:

1. 数据驱动的可视化

知识库构建技术可以通过语义分析和向量检索,实现数据驱动的可视化。例如,可以通过知识库提取实体和关系,进而生成动态的可视化图表。

2. 智能交互

知识库构建技术可以通过语义分析和向量检索,实现智能交互。例如,用户可以通过自然语言查询知识库,进而获得相关的可视化结果。

3. 深度洞察

知识库构建技术可以通过语义分析和向量检索,实现深度洞察。例如,可以通过知识库分析数据中的隐含关系,进而生成更深层次的可视化结果。


结论

知识库构建技术是企业数字化转型的核心驱动力之一,其通过语义分析和向量检索的结合,能够帮助企业更高效地管理和利用海量数据。在数据中台、数字孪生和数字可视化等领域,知识库构建技术的应用已经取得了显著的成果。未来,随着人工智能和大数据技术的不断发展,知识库构建技术将为企业带来更多的可能性。

如果您对知识库构建技术感兴趣,可以申请试用相关工具,体验其带来的高效和便捷。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料